LEO Satellites: Revolutionizing Global Connectivity with WordPress

LEO satellites, or Low Earth Orbit satellites, are a type of satellite that orbits the Earth at an altitude of around 160 to 2,000 kilometers. These satellites have been gaining popularity in recent years due to their ability to provide high-speed, low-latency internet connectivity to remote and underserved areas. LEO satellites are an attractive solution for providing internet connectivity to areas where traditional infrastructure is lacking. They are able to offer speeds of up to 1 Gbps and latencies as low as 20 ms, making them ideal for applications such as video streaming, online gaming, and cloud computing. Additionally, LEO satellites are able to provide connectivity to areas that are difficult or impossible to reach with traditional infrastructure, such as remote villages or areas affected by natural disasters.

The Benefits of LEO Satellites

There are several benefits to using LEO satellites for global connectivity. One of the main advantages is their ability to provide high-speed internet connectivity to remote and underserved areas. This can have a significant impact on the economic and social development of these areas, as it provides access to information, education, and economic opportunities. Additionally, LEO satellites are able to provide connectivity in areas where traditional infrastructure is lacking, making them an ideal solution for emergency response and disaster relief situations.

Another benefit of LEO satellites is their low latency. Traditional geostationary satellites have a latency of around 600 ms, which can make them unsuitable for applications that require real-time communication. LEO satellites, on the other hand, have a latency of as low as 20 ms, making them ideal for applications such as video conferencing, online gaming, and cloud computing.
